From 9b3fedde27d3d63055c43c05e8254e252e58ba48 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Lukasz Anaczkowski Date: Wed, 9 Sep 2015 15:47:28 +0200 Subject: [PATCH] ACPI / tables: Add acpi_subtable_proc to ACPI table parsers ACPI subtable parsing needs to be extended to allow two or more handlers to be run in the same ACPI table walk, thus adding acpi_subtable_proc structure which stores () ACPI table id () handler that processes table () counter how many items has been processed and passing it to acpi_parse_entries_array() and acpi_table_parse_entries_array(). This is needed to fix CPU enumeration when APIC/X2APIC entries are interleaved. Signed-off-by: Lukasz Anaczkowski Reviewed-by: Marc Zyngier Tested-by: Marc Zyngier Signed-off-by: Rafael J.
